– System: The method will involve the singer amplifying the all-natural overtones of their voice. Although singing a essential pitch, the singer modulates The form of their vocal tract to isolate and amplify specific overtones (harmonics), creating the notion of various notes remaining sung at the same time.

Extra professional choirs may perhaps sing with the voices all blended. In some cases singers of the exact same voice are grouped in pairs or threes. Proponents of this technique argue that it can make it a lot easier for every particular person singer to listen to and tune to another components, however it involves far more independence from Every single singer. Opponents argue that this method loses the spatial separation of unique voice traces, an or else valuable element for the viewers, and that it eradicates sectional resonance, which lessens the productive quantity in the refrain.
